Feb 1 union budget will benefit BJP, opposition parties writes to Prez, CEC

New Delhi: The opposition parties led by Congress welcomed the declaration of election dates of five states. But, before the face-off in the elections, sixteen opposition parties, including Congress, are set to take on Bharatiya Janata Party government.

They have written to President Pranab Mukherjee and Chief Election Commissioner, saying, the advance in budget could influence assembly elections in the favour of saffron party.

Meanwhile, the budget session, which begins in the third week of February, would begin from January 31, decided Cabinet Committee on Parliamentary Affairs (CCPA) on Wednesday.

The opposition parties shot off a letter earlier this week questioning BJP’s intent. Parties said if budget session gets advanced, then it will act as hindrance in free and fair elections.

The letter was signed by several party leaders including Ghulam Nabi Azad, Sitaram Yechury (CPI(M), Ram Gopal Yadav (SP) and Sharad Yadav {JD(U)}.
